From
https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1013294:
"After having problem with Jboss Openshifts 4.0 not being able to connect to
openshift servers resolved by a recent update, now I have three applications on a domain.
Am able to manage two of those application but one always returns "Unable to create
SSH session for application 'main' Auth fail" whenever I try to manage the
application with JBoss openshift tools for Zend Studio. After investigating for a while I
noticed that the UUID for the two applications are was able to access were the same as the
username in the git url. However for the one that am unable to access the UUID is
different from the username in the git url. Management with rhc and other ssh tools work
but I need the JBoss tools because they make work easier. Is there any way I can update
the UUID in JBoss Openshift tools."
